Description

More than just the usual light-cycle game, this is a full clone of the Tron coin-op game with all four sequences; Spiders, MCP, Light Cycles, and Tanks. It's all here, the spiders even multiply by division.

Spiders
Simply walk into the structure in the center of the room. Except there are four-legged digital spiders in your way. And every few minutes, they split into additional four-legged digital spiders. This alone creates an urgency to exit the room, but there is also countdown to certain death.

MCP
Players dive into the beam of light and are pulled up to be smashed into the MCP's circular wall of shields. Players can remove sections of the shield but new sections always scroll in from the left. Punch a hole and run through.

Tank
It's Pac-Man, with shooting TANKS!. Shoot all the enemy tanks and escape.

Light Cycles
The classic snake game for two or more players where the snake grows as fast as it moves. Cycles make 90° turns and leave an ever present trail of harmful light wherever they go; don't go into the light.

Play each game and they all reset to a harder version to play again, 12 times! What happens after the 12th win, someone would have to accomplish that for us to know :)
